Collaborative Canvas

This app allows multiple users to interact remotely on a collaborative canvas and feel each other’s presence, via their web browser. Each user has a specific color that identifies them.
I decided to change the original drawing app in order to avoid filling the canvas completely, so each stroke disappears after a few seconds on the screen.

I used P5.js, and node.js

Reference from Live web syllabus and P5 tutorial


